Ponce Inlet and West DeLand are places in Florida.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Ponce Inlet has the higher population (3,392 vs 3,278 in West DeLand). Ponce Inlet has the higher median household income ($100,313 vs $68,559 in West DeLand). Ponce Inlet has the higher median home value ($502,100 vs $233,100 in West DeLand).
